Dynamic Access Control

Algorithm

Dynamic Access Control, within cryptocurrency and derivatives, represents a programmatic framework governing permissions to interact with smart contracts or decentralized applications. This control isn’t static; it adjusts based on pre-defined conditions, often incorporating real-time market data or on-chain events, influencing trading limits or access to specific financial instruments. Implementation relies on cryptographic techniques and verifiable computation, ensuring transparency and auditability of access modifications, crucial for mitigating systemic risk in decentralized finance. The sophistication of these algorithms directly impacts the resilience of protocols against manipulation and unauthorized activity.
